Grand Junction, Colo.
Realtor Sid Squirrell, owner of a marijuana grow operation in the same office building as a government office, declined to comment Saturday evening.
According to police records, Squirrell has been in Mexico since before the search of his grow operation. The search affidavit states he is with the owner of Naturals Wellness Center, the medical marijuana dispensary he says he’s supplying.
Investigators are busy checking patients records found during the search to see if Squirrell’s growing operation was legal.
